District Overview

Kiewit Engineering Group, Inc is a full-service consulting and engineering firm serving the infrastructure and energy markets. Our combined staff of more than 3,700 engineers and design professionals have expertise that spans all major engineering disciplines to serve industrial, transportation, power, water, mining, marine, building and oil, gas & chemical markets. Backed by over 140 years of construction experience, our construction-driven engineering focuses on constructability and safety in the earliest phases of projects to ensure on-time and on-budget project delivery.

Our rapidly growing Industrial and Water Engineering Group, which includes mechanical, process, electrical, controls, structural and architectural disciplines, is a multi-faceted and leading-edge division of Kiewit with best-in-class technical expertise focused on EPC and design-build delivery. The Industrial Group projects span markets such as advanced technologies; mining, minerals and metals; process industries; industrial energy; drinking water; wastewater treatment and biosolids; desalination; and industrial water.

Responsibilities
  • Have a basic understanding of building mechanical, electrical, and plumbing systems.
  • Close to moderate supervision by a more experienced architect and/or engineer.
  • Develop familiarity with departmental design standards, applicable codes, policies, guidelines, and standards.
  • Become familiar with building codes and standards for the design of building MEP systems.
  • Under the guidance of other engineers, support the system design concept, equipment sizing, equipment selection, system controls, and the finalized design for industrial buildings and administration buildings including: offices, server/computer rooms, warehouses, F type industrial, H type industrial, and Class I, Division 1 & 2.
  • Under the guidance of other engineers, prepare production drawings and specifications for building-related lighting, power, HVAC, and plumbing systems that will be used in deliverable packages sent to sub-contractors for bidding.
  • Assist with technical bid analysis reviews.
  • Verify HVAC and plumbing installation/construction compliance with engineering specifications and plan requirements, and coordinate shop drawings and other equipment submittals during construction administration.
  • Check and navigate 3D models for review of interferences and constructability during design and construction administration.
Qualifications
  • Pursuing a Bachelor's or Master's degree in Architectural Engineering (with a mechanical or MEP focus)
  • GPA above 3.0 preferred
  • Familiar with Revit and AutoCAD
  • Familiar with building MEP systems design software such as Trane Trace 700 or Carrier HAP is a plus
